Defence Forces: We are conducting not positional, but active defense

Russian forces have concentrated significant troops and equipment in the Huliaipole and Oleksandrivka directions, but Ukraine’s Defense Forces are conducting active maneuver defense operations and destroying Russian infiltration groups.

This was stated by Vladyslav Voloshyn, spokesperson for Ukraine’s Southern Defense Forces.

“In the Huliaipole and Oleksandrivka directions, the enemy has now concentrated a fairly large number of forces and assets… in fact, units from three enemy armies — the 5th, 29th, 36th, and even the 35th Army — are attempting assault operations to push Ukraine’s Defense Forces deeper into our defensive lines. Therefore, the situation is quite difficult,” Voloshyn said.

At the same time, he refuted claims from Russian sources about an alleged Ukrainian counteroffensive, explaining that the operations in question involve eliminating Russian groups that had infiltrated.

“In reality, it looks like this: it is the clearing of enemy groups that infiltrated deep into our defenses,” Voloshyn emphasized.

According to him, in Ternuvate, Kosivtseve, Prydorozhne, and Lukianivka, Russian groups carried out photo and video recording, but the Defense Forces cleared these settlements.

Voloshyn also added that Ukrainian units conduct active operations every day.

“We have indeed taken control of a certain number of areas in the gray zone, carrying out up to two dozen search-and-strike and reconnaissance-search operations daily, and destroying enemy infiltration groups,” the spokesperson assured.

He stressed that this is not a classic offensive.

“This is not a classic counteroffensive… we are conducting not positional, but active defense,” Voloshyn said.

According to the spokesperson, the Defense Forces are implementing maneuver defense.

“We conduct maneuver defense, and then destroy and push the enemy back as far as possible, not allowing them to gain a foothold in the positions they have occupied,” Voloshyn explained.
